Guys...cool down. Let me clarify u 1 thing, Vodafone does session based billing. So in a session if u d/l 6 KB it wud get rounded off to 10 KB & the same is also mentioned in their site. Even I got bugged up the 1st time I rcvd the bill. The best way to bring down the cost is to either remain connected throughout (by setting your GPRS connection settings to "Always ON" from "When Needed") else maintaining a longer session connectivity time. If you are a postpaid subscriber, download ur bill from ur online My Vodafone account. They hv a small bug with their system - they charge Rs.75 for Itemized Billing for certain plans, but u can get complete Itemized Bill free of cost by downloading the same thing from the net. :P
